The stand-alone Jigsaw Programme, Jigsaw, the mindful approach to PSHE, (available as digital download with optional hard copy folders), is a well-structured scheme of work for PSHE, including a lesson a week for ages 3-16, with all the teaching and learning resources needed to deliver it, making it a gift for teachers and students alike. The whole-school approach includes progression and assessment. All statutory RSHE requirements are met, learning is engaging, and the impact is tried and tested across thousands of schools. Mindfulness practice in every lesson supports mental health and self-regulation. The programme includes ongoing free support and updates. Both the primary (3-11) and secondary (11-16) Jigsaw Programmes meet all statutory RSHE requirements in the context of this whole-school comprehensive approach to PSHE, and make a significant contribution to personal development, SMSC, British values, the equality duty and safeguarding. The comprehensive nature of Jigsaw saves teachersmany hours of planning time so they can focus on delivering PSHE to meet their students’needs. The Community Area offers a wealth of support for teacher and subject leader alike, with knowledge organisers, mapping documents, editable sample policies, training materials, parent information, ongoing updates and much more. The programme comprises six half-term Puzzles (units), every year group working on the same Puzzle at the same time at its own level, meaning the learning can deepen and broaden each year through our spiral curriculum. There are six lesson plans in each Puzzle, with all the teaching resources needed to deliver them. Secondary lessons are in PowerPoint format with teacher notes beneath the slides and student learning tasks included. Each lesson ends with Finishing Facts and signposting to further information and support. The Puzzles, sequential from the beginning to the end of the school year, are a follows: Being Me in MyWorld; Celebrating Difference; Dreams and Goals; Healthy Me; Relationships;ChangingMe. At primary level, each Puzzle is launched with an assembly and the learning messages reinforced with the original Jigsaw songs, which also help engender a sense of community. A safe learning environment is created with the Jigsaw Charter, and the whole programme is grounded in sound psychology.
